Florianopolis

With a population of almost 500,000, Florianopolis is the capital city of the state of Santa Catarina in southern Brazil. The city is split between mainland Brazil and Santa Catarina Island.

Florianopolis has grown in popularity with tourists recently because of its wonderful scenery, beautiful beaches, and fascinating culture. Many Brazilians have also moved here, leaving behind the big cities of Sao Paulo and Rio de Janeiro.

Florianopolis has a warm humid subtropical climate. There are summer, winter, spring and fall seasons. Frosts are rare but do occur occasionally. Highs during the warmest months are usually in the high 70s Fahrenheit. Rain is evenly distributed throughout the year and there is no distinct dry season.

Curitiba

Curitiba is a relatively large city that is convenient to visit if you're traveling to Iguazu Falls from either Rio de Janeiro or Sao Paulo. It is worth a day or two stop over because it has a great old city that has been restored. It's also the capital of Parana, Brazil. Curitiba is one of the more wealthy cities in the southern region of Brazil. It has a diverse population with many immigrants and some interesting cultural events.

Which place is cheaper, Curitiba or Florianopolis?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Florianopolis is $62, while the average daily cost in Curitiba is $73.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When we compare the travel costs of actual travelers between Florianopolis and Curitiba, we can see that Curitiba is more expensive. And not only is Florianopolis much less expensive, but it is actually a significantly cheaper destination. So, traveling to Florianopolis would let you spend less money overall. Or, you could decide to spend more money in Florianopolis and be able to afford a more luxurious travel style by staying in nicer hotels, eating at more expensive restaurants, taking tours, and experiencing more activities. The same level of travel in Curitiba would naturally cost you much more money, so you would probably want to keep your budget a little tighter in Curitiba than you might in Florianopolis.

Which is Bigger, Florianopolis or Curitiba?

Curitiba has a larger population, and is about 4 times larger than the population of Florianopolis. When comparing the sizes of Florianopolis and Curitiba, keep in mind that a larger population does not always imply the destination has more attractions or better activities.
